In physics, sound energy is a form of energy that can be heard by living things. Only those waves that have a frequency of 16 Hz to 20 kHz are audible to humans. However, this range is an average and will slightly change from individual to individual.

Finding ʻOhana is a 2021 American family adventure film [1] by Jude Weng in her directorial debut and written by Christina Strain. The film stars Kea Peahu, Alex Aiono, Lindsay Watson, Owen Vaccaro and Kelly Hu. It premiered on Netflix on January 29, 2021. [2]

Lah-Lah's Adventures is a pre-school music television series. It went to air on 7TWO on 28 April 2014, for 26 episodes of 12 minutes. It also aired on CBeebies in Australia as well as on BBC Kids and Knowledge Network in Canada.
